Position: Fluid Systems Engineer – Heat Exchanger Design
We are seeking a driven and technically skilled
Fluid Systems Engineer
with specialized expertise in
heat exchanger design
to join our dynamic engineering team. This role is central to the development and optimization of heat exchangers across a variety of thermal systems, with an emphasis on performance, reliability, cost-effectiveness, and manufacturability.
The ideal candidate brings a strong foundation in both
thermal-fluid analysis
and
mechanical design , along with experience working cross-functionally with manufacturing, supply chain, and thermal systems teams. This position will play a key role in advancing our
secondary cooling loop
and related thermal technologies.
Key Responsibilities:
Design and develop various types of heat exchangers (e.g., shell-and-tube, plate-fin, air-cooled, printed circuit) from concept through prototype and production stages, tailored to system requirements.
Create detailed CAD models and production-ready manufacturing drawings using
Siemens NX .
Perform thermal-fluid simulations using tools such as
ANSYS Fluent ,
COMSOL , or proprietary software to evaluate heat transfer, pressure drop, and flow distribution.
Optimize designs for performance and efficiency, focusing on fin geometry, fluid path layout, and flow uniformity.
Incorporate
Design for Manufacturability (DFM)
principles early in the design process to ensure cost-effective, scalable solutions.
Collaborate with suppliers and vendors to assess component feasibility, manufacturing methods, and cost drivers.
Ensure compliance with applicable codes, standards, and regulatory requirements, including
ASME Section VIII .
Participate in regular design reviews and cross-disciplinary technical discussions.
Required Qualifications:
Bachelor’s or Master’s degree in Mechanical Engineering or a closely related field.
Minimum of
3 years
of experience in heat exchanger or fluid component design in a high-performance hardware setting.
Proficient in 3D CAD tools (e.g.,
Siemens NX ,
SolidWorks , or equivalent).
Hands-on experience with simulation and analysis tools (e.g.,
STAR-CCM+, ANSYS , or similar).
Proven application of DFM principles in a product development environment.
Strong written and verbal communication skills, including technical documentation.
